Skip to content
Awesome 3D ball multiplatform mobile game coded in ShiVa3D. These files represent AI code extracted from Stonetrip's Shiva PLE game engine. Visit my blog at http://subspacegames.com for links to the videos documenting this code and links to the game prototype - playable in your web browser.
Lua
Branch: master
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
AimCamAI_Function_aiming.lua
AimCamAI_Function_centerMouse.lua
AimCamAI_Function_checkMovingObject.lua
AimCamAI_Function_convertHudCoords.lua
AimCamAI_Function_editing.lua
AimCamAI_Function_launchBall.lua
AimCamAI_Function_mouseOverComponent.lua
AimCamAI_Function_setCrosshairVisibility.lua
AimCamAI_Function_setCursorVisibility.lua
AimCamAI_Function_turnEnds.lua
AimCamAI_Handler_onEnterFrame.lua
AimCamAI_Handler_onInit.lua
AimCamAI_Handler_onLevelCompleted.lua
AimCamAI_Handler_onMouseButtonDown.lua
AimCamAI_Handler_onMouseButtonUp.lua
AimCamAI_Handler_onMouseMove.lua
AimCamAI_Handler_onMoveSelector.lua
AimCamAI_Handler_onToggleCamera.lua
AimCamAI_Handler_onTurnEnds.lua
BallAI_Function_PauseEffects.lua
BallAI_Function_StartEffects.lua
BallAI_Handler_onEnterFrame.lua
BallAI_Handler_onInit.lua
BallAI_Handler_onLaunch.lua
BallAI_Handler_onPauseEffects.lua
BallAI_Handler_onReset.lua
BallAI_Handler_onStartEffects.lua
ChaseCamAI_Handler_onEnterFrame.lua
ChaseCamAI_Handler_onInit.lua
ChaseCamAI_Handler_onReset.lua
FireAI_Handler_onInit.lua
FireAI_Handler_onReset.lua
FireAI_Handler_onSensorCollision.lua
GasSwitchAI_Handler_onInit.lua
GasSwitchAI_Handler_onSensorCollision.lua
MainAI_Function_ParseXML.lua
MainAI_Handler_onInit.lua
MainAI_Handler_onKeyboardKeyDown.lua
MainAI_Handler_onMouseButtonDown.lua
MainAI_Handler_onMouseButtonUp.lua
MainAI_Handler_onMouseMove.lua
MainAI_Handler_onNextLevel.lua
MainAI_State_GetXML_onEnter.lua
MainAI_State_GetXML_onLeave.lua
MainAI_State_GetXML_onLoop.lua
MainAI_State_Idle_onEnter.lua
MainAI_State_Idle_onLeave.lua
MainAI_State_Idle_onLoop.lua
MovableAI_Function_convertHudCoords.lua
MovableAI_Handler_onInit.lua
MovableAI_Handler_onMouseMove.lua
MovableAI_Handler_onRotateObject.lua
OverheadCamAI_Handler_onEnterFrame.lua
OverheadCamAI_Handler_onInit.lua
README
SpringboardAI_Handler_onSensorCollision.lua
TargetAI_Handler_onInit.lua
TargetAI_Handler_onSensorCollision.lua
TeleporterAI_Handler_onInit.lua
TeleporterAI_Handler_onSensorCollision.lua
You can’t perform that action at this time.